The Use of Oxazolidinone Products in the Treatment of rinary Infections

Journal Title: Нирки - Year 2015, Vol 4, Issue 14

Abstract

The clinical efficacy of oxazolidinones with a focus on linezolid application in urinary infections is presented. High activity of the drug in methicillin-resistant Staphylococcus aureus, Enterococcus faecium and Enterococcus faecalis resistant to vancomycin is discussed. Most common situations for effective use of linezolid are defined: septic conditions and the long carriage of the mentioned pathogens.
